Guild Wars 2 – Help the People of Ebonhawke

“Tear down Separatist propaganda, talk down sympathizers, and knock on doors to find potential Separatist hideouts.”

Head toward the center of town. There you will find Fallen Angel Makayla. She will explain more of what the Separatists are after here.

As you wander the streets of Ebonhawke it will not be hard to find the sympathizers. They will be very vocal about maintaining things as they are. They do not want a treaty with the Charr. Some you can simply talk with and they will eventually come around, admitting they need time to accept the changes. It is a very big deal out in Ebonhawke as they have been constantly under siege for decades by the Charr. They do not seem to get that this would mean peace and the war around Ebonhawke would stop.

Wander the streets and look to the sides. You will find the occasional suspicious door. Investigating that will call out a Separatist of some nature who will come and attack you. If you are ready, it is nothing too bad to handle. It will take some effort if you are below 25 and only in light armor.

When the renown quest is complete you will get the letter, “A Fire Untended” with 1 silver 50 copper:

Return to Makayla because she will now be selling the following Karma Items:
Broken Flute: 273 Karma
Accessory: +8 Vitality, +11 Condition Damage, Lvl. 30

Thackeray Family Replica Ring: 329 Karma
Ring: +10 Vitality, +13 Condition Damage

Broken Flute: 546 Karma
Accessory: +9 Vitality, +12 Condition Damage, Lvl. 30

Thackeray Family Replica Ring: 651 Karma
Ring: +11 Vitality, +15 Condition Damage

Avocados in Bulk: 77 Karma
Double-click to unbundle 25 Avocados
